This state-of-the-art transit network, stretching approximately 31 miles, is poised to redefine passenger connectivity for what is destined to become the world\u2019s largest aviation hub.<\/p>\n<p>The project, which represents a critical component of Dubai\u2019s $35-billion expansion strategy, will feature a nine-station configuration serviced by a fleet of 165 automated vehicles. With a target completion date of December 2031, the system is designed to facilitate the seamless movement of millions of passengers across an expansive 27-square-mile site.<\/p>\n<h2>The Consortium and Engineering Scope<\/h2>\n<p>The contract, awarded by the Dubai Aviation City Corp. (DACC), highlights the strategic collaboration between Japanese engineering precision and Indian construction expertise. MHI will spearhead the project, working alongside its Dubai-based subsidiary, MHI Mobility Engineering Services, and the Mumbai-based infrastructure giant, Larsen &amp; Toubro (L&amp;T) Ltd.<\/p>\n<p>Under the terms of the agreement, MHI and its subsidiary will retain primary responsibility for the high-tech components of the system: the design, procurement, and rigorous testing of the automated vehicles and the sophisticated signaling systems. Furthermore, MHI will oversee the complex task of overall system integration, ensuring that the APM operates in perfect harmony with the airport\u2019s broader technological ecosystem.<\/p>\n<p>Larsen &amp; Toubro, meanwhile, has been tasked with the physical realization of the transit network. L&amp;T will design and procure secondary subsystems while taking the lead on all on-site construction activities. While the financial details of the contract remain confidential, industry analysts suggest that the scale of the project\u2014which involves tunneling beneath an active airfield\u2014places it among the most significant infrastructure investments of the decade.<\/p>\n<h2>A Chronology of the Al Maktoum Mega-Project<\/h2>\n<p>The evolution of Al Maktoum International from a secondary facility into the future centerpiece of Dubai\u2019s aviation strategy has been a multi-year, meticulously phased endeavor.<\/p>\n<figure class=\"article-inline-figure\"><img decoding=\"async\" src=\"https:\/\/www.enr.com\/ext\/resources\/2026\/08\/20\/MHI.jpg?height=635&amp;t=1787317270&amp;width=1200\" alt=\"MHI, L&amp;T Win Contract for 31-Mile People Mover at New $35B Dubai Airport\" class=\"article-inline-img\" loading=\"lazy\" \/><\/figure>\n<ul>\n<li><strong>2024:<\/strong> The Dubai government officially unveiled the $35-billion master plan to transform Al Maktoum into the world&#8217;s largest airport. The expansion was framed as a strategic necessity to accommodate the next 40 years of anticipated growth, with the eventual capacity to handle over 260 million passengers annually.<\/li>\n<li><strong>June 2026:<\/strong> Dubai Aviation Engineering Projects (DAEP) confirmed that construction momentum was accelerating, with over $3.5 billion in contracts already under execution. Preparations were finalized for the release of an additional $15 billion in work packages.<\/li>\n<li><strong>August 20, 2026:<\/strong> MHI is officially announced as the lead for the APM system, cementing the transition from the master-planning phase to specialized implementation.<\/li>\n<li><strong>December 2031:<\/strong> The scheduled completion date for the APM network, serving as a critical milestone before the airport\u2019s full-scale operational debut.<\/li>\n<li><strong>2032:<\/strong> The anticipated opening of the fully expanded Al Maktoum International Airport, which is projected to surpass Dubai International Airport as the emirate\u2019s primary aviation gateway.<\/li>\n<\/ul>\n<h2>Supporting Data and System Scale<\/h2>\n<p>The sheer magnitude of the Al Maktoum APM system is unprecedented. At 31 miles in total track length, the network is designed to dwarf existing airport transit systems. For comparison, the Skylink at Dallas-Fort Worth International Airport\u2014widely considered a benchmark for efficient airport transit\u2014consists of 4.81 miles of elevated track per loop. The Dubai system, by contrast, will feature multiple tracks running deep beneath the aircraft apron, connecting a series of sprawling terminals and concourses.<\/p>\n<p>The terminal infrastructure that the APM will serve is equally staggering in scale. Each individual concourse is designed to span approximately 24.8 million square feet and extend over 1.7 miles in length. These concourses will house 100 boarding gates each, with the APM providing direct access at central passenger hubs to minimize walking distances. The West Terminal, a seven-level structure, is planned to encompass 8.6 million square feet, with an annual capacity of 45 million passengers.<\/p>\n<p>The construction requirements reflect the complexity of building beneath an operating airfield. Current progress includes:<\/p>\n<ul>\n<li><strong>Earthworks:<\/strong> Excavation exceeding 58.9 million cubic yards.<\/li>\n<li><strong>Foundation:<\/strong> The installation of over 17,000 concrete piles.<\/li>\n<li><strong>Core Infrastructure:<\/strong> Utilization of approximately 5.9 million cubic yards of concrete to date.<\/li>\n<\/ul>\n<h2>Official Perspectives: A Vision for the Future<\/h2>\n<p>The strategic importance of this project was underscored by Sheikh Ahmed bin Saeed, Dubai\u2019s second deputy ruler, who noted in 2024 that the new airport would be over five times the size of the current Dubai International. &quot;This project will prepare the ground for the next 40 years of growth,&quot; he stated, emphasizing the emirate&#8217;s commitment to maintaining its position as the global crossroads of travel.<\/p>\n<p>Suzanne Al Anani, CEO of Dubai Aviation Engineering Projects (DAEP), has been instrumental in organizing the vast array of construction packages required to realize this vision. In recent briefings, Al Anani highlighted that the APM is being integrated alongside a highly sophisticated, automated baggage-handling system. This system, featuring underground galleries and batch centers, is designed to process an incredible 30,000 bags per hour. Utilizing automated guided vehicles, luggage will be delivered directly to aircraft stands via pop-up hatches, a design feature that ensures minimal interference with ground-handling operations.<\/p>\n<h2>Operational and Strategic Implications<\/h2>\n<p>The shift in configuration from the previously proposed four-station system to the currently announced nine-station system reflects the dynamic nature of the project. While DAEP\u2019s earlier documentation suggested a phased approach starting with a limited underground loop, the current MHI-led configuration indicates a more robust initial rollout. This suggests that the planners have prioritized high-capacity, system-wide connectivity from the earliest possible stage of the airport&#8217;s opening.<\/p>\n<figure class=\"article-inline-figure\"><img decoding=\"async\" src=\"https:\/\/www.enr.com\/ext\/resources\/2026\/08\/20\/APM-Route.jpg\" alt=\"MHI, L&amp;T Win Contract for 31-Mile People Mover at New $35B Dubai Airport\" class=\"article-inline-img\" loading=\"lazy\" \/><\/figure>\n<h3>Impact on Global Aviation<\/h3>\n<p>The competition between hub airports is fierce, and Al Maktoum\u2019s development is a direct challenge to established major airports in Europe and Asia. The necessity of maintaining strict safety protocols while excavating for tunnels and stations beneath heavy-load aprons requires advanced geotechnical and structural engineering. The collaboration between MHI and L&amp;T suggests a division of labor that leverages Japanese expertise in high-speed, automated rail transit with L&amp;T\u2019s proven track record in executing large-scale, high-complexity civil infrastructure projects in the Middle East.<\/p>\n<h3>Economic and Sustainability Goals<\/h3>\n<p>The project is not merely an exercise in size; it is an exercise in future-proofing. With five parallel runways\u2014each roughly 2.8 miles long\u2014designed to allow four simultaneous parallel approaches, the airport is being built to handle the highest possible frequency of Code F aircraft. The emphasis on district cooling plants, power generation, and efficient baggage handling suggests a commitment to sustainability, ensuring that the massive footprint remains operationally viable and energy-efficient over the coming decades.<\/p>\n<h2>Conclusion<\/h2>\n<p>As the clock ticks toward the 2032 operational launch, the Al Maktoum International Airport project stands as a testament to Dubai\u2019s unwavering ambition.
